The ingredients needed to make Shrimp and Scallop Doria with Handmade Sauce:
  1. Take 200 grams x 2 packages Assorted shrimp and scallops
  2. Get 1 Onion, sliced
  3. Take 2 tbsp Olive oil
  4. Prepare 1 tbsp Butter
  5. Make ready 1 Salt and pepper
  6. Get 100 ml White wine
  7. Make ready 1 use as much (to taste) Hot cooked white rice
  8. Prepare 1 Parmesan cheese
  9. Prepare 1 Parsley (dried)
  10. Get Basic White Sauce (Recipe ID: 1449234)
  11. Take 60 grams Unsalted butter
  12. Take 60 grams White flour
  13. Take 1000 ml Milk
  14. Make ready 1 leaf Bay leaf
  15. Get 1 dash Nutmeg
  16. Take 200 ml Heavy cream
  17. Make ready 1 1/2 tbsp Consommé stock granules
  18. Get 1 Salt
Instructions to make Shrimp and Scallop Doria with Handmade Sauce:
  1. Slowly melt the butter in a frying pan over low heat, add the sifted flour and cook while making sure it doesn't burn. (See here for more instructions: https://cookpad.com/en/recipes/150056-easy-basic-white-sauce)
  2. After turning off the heat, add warmed milk in 2 turns to step one, and briskly whisk it all together with an eggbeater.
  3. Add the bay leaf and nutmeg to Step 2, stewing it at a low heat for about 5 minutes, and then flavor it with fresh cream and consommé stock granules.
  4. Heat up the butter and olive oil in a frying pan, and add the shrimp and scallops in white whine after frying the onions; add salt and pepper and evaporate the alcoholic content.
  5. Mix rice and the white sauce from Step 3 together in a bowl (about 4 ladles' worth).
  6. Add it to the frying pan with the remaining white sauce from Step 4, and bring it to a boil after mixing it thoroughly.
  7. Add rice, sauce, cheese, and parsley in that order to the gratin pans and cook at 200℃ (about 392℉) for 10 minutes.
